Tonight, all over this country and on US military bases abroad, tens-of-thousands of children will go to bed praying that their dads or moms (or, in some cases, both) will come home safely from serving in the wars in Iraq and Afghanistan.

At Fort Leavenworth, Kansas, there is a very cool program at the elementary schools called "Hearts Apart" for kids whose parents are deployed abroad. Students get together a couple times a month to hang out and have some fun -- just to maybe take their minds somewhere else briefly and to let them know that they are not alone.
